Vibrating Fluidized Bed Dryer
The scope of application:
1. Food: chicken essence, seafood essence, monosodium glutamate,
citric acid, xylitol, maltitol, sorbitol, dehydrated vegetables,
calcium lactate, wine tank, monosodium glutamate, sugar, salt,
slag, watercress, seeds, etc.
2. Pharmaceutical and chemical industry: various tableting
granules, ammonium sulfate, thiourea dioxide, NOBS, boric acid,
borax, diphenol, malic acid, maleic acid, etc.
3. It can also be used for cooling and humidification of materials.
Features:
1. The material is heated evenly, the heat exchange is sufficient,
the drying intensity is high, and the energy saving is about 30%
compared with the ordinary dryer.
2. The vibration source is driven by a vibration motor, with stable
operation, convenient maintenance, low noise and long service life.
3. The fluidization is stable, and there is no dead angle and
blow-through phenomenon.
4. Good adjustability, adaptable to face width.
5. It has little damage to the surface of the material, and can be
used for drying of fragile materials. It does not affect the
working effect when the material particles are irregular.
6. The fully enclosed structure effectively prevents
cross-contamination between materials and air, and the working
environment is clean.

Overview:
The material enters the machine from the feeding port. Under the
action of the vibration force, the material is thrown in the
horizontal direction and moves forward continuously. The hot air
passes through the fluidized bed and exchanges heat with the wet
material. Discharge, the dry material is discharged from the
discharge port.
The method of segmented heating is adopted. The pre-drying section
adopts high pressure and low air volume fan, so that the wet
material can be completely fluidized; the drying section adopts low
pressure and high air volume fan, which can take away more water
per unit time and dry evenly; the cooling section adopts The high
air volume fan can quickly take away heat and reduce the
temperature of the product, which not only meets the requirements
of moisture control, but also facilitates the subsequent packaging
process.
1. Drying medium circulation system: The blower, heater and air
inlet pipe are made of stainless steel to avoid the possibility of
product being polluted by unclean air.
2. The quick-opening structure is adopted between the upper and
lower beds of the drying machine, which changes the bolt-fixed
connection of the traditional structure, which greatly facilitates
the thorough cleaning of the system.
3. The hole pattern of the material bed plate adopts a combined
structure, and the front section adopts a tongue-shaped hole, so
that the material can move forward smoothly without leakage; the
middle and rear end adopt straight holes, the penetration rate of
hot air is higher, drying The heat exchange of the process is more
complete.
4. The lower bed is supported by stainless steel seamless steel
pipe, the bed structure is stronger and the service life is long.
5. The interior of the lower bed is made of stainless steel fully
welded to prevent sewage from entering the insulation layer during
cleaning, thereby affecting the quality of the product, and a
cleaning port is also provided to facilitate cleaning of the
equipment.
